Fioravanti G, Bocci Benucci S, Ghinassi S. Psychological risk factors for problematic social network use: An overview of systematic reviews and meta-analyses. Addict Behav Rep 2025; 21:100600. [PMID: 40231232 PMCID: PMC11994906 DOI: 10.1016/j.abrep.2025.100600]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/27/2024] [Revised: 03/06/2025] [Accepted: 03/21/2025] [Indexed: 04/16/2025] Open
Abstract
Problematic Social Network Use (PSNU) is a widespread and harmful public health issue. Therefore, it is unsurprising that the literature has focused on identifying possible risk factors contributing to this behavior. However, most identified factors were found to be shared with other problematic online behaviors. Therefore, the present overview aims to identify the psychological risk factors consistently associated with PSNU and evaluate whether the emerging risk factors were shared across Internet Gaming Disorder, Problematic Pornography Use, and Compulsive Online Shopping. A systematic search of four databases was conducted to identify systematic reviews/meta-analyses investigating the relationship between PSNU and psychological risk factors. Then, a bibliometric analysis was performed to examine whether the identified factors were shared across other problematic online behaviors. Thirty-five systematic reviews/meta-analyses were included, examining general and behavior-specific predisposing factors. General predisposing factors associated with PSNU included insecure attachment, high neuroticism, low conscientiousness, low self-esteem, depression, anxiety, stress, social anxiety, loneliness, and fear of missing out. Behavior-specific factors, though less frequently studied, highlighted the role of unmet psychological needs, Preference for Online Social Interaction, and motives related to emotion regulation and socialization. The bibliometric analysis revealed that many risk factors for PSNSU are shared with other problematic online behaviors. However, certain specificities emerged, including distinct motivations driving these behaviors. Findings suggest that PSNU shares a spectrum of risk factors with other problematic online behaviors, yet specific etiological and motivational differences remain. Overall, the findings underscore integrating shared and specific risk factors to improve tailored prevention and intervention strategies.

Liu SJ, Zhang X, Yan LJ, Wang HC, Ding ZN, Liu H, Pan GQ, Han CL, Tian BW, Dong ZR, Wang DX, Yan YC, Li T. Comparison of tenofovir versus entecavir for preventing hepatocellular carcinoma in chronic hepatitis B patients: an umbrella review and meta-analysis. J Cancer Res Clin Oncol 2025; 151:77. [PMID: 39934513 PMCID: PMC11814049 DOI: 10.1007/s00432-025-06082-4]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/01/2024] [Accepted: 01/02/2025] [Indexed: 02/13/2025]
Abstract
There are several meta-analyses about the comparison of tenofovir disoproxil fumarate (TDF) versus entecavir (ETV) for preventing hepatocellular carcinoma in patients with chronic HBV infection published in recent years. However, the conclusions vary considerably. This umbrella review aims to consolidate evidence from various systematic reviews to evaluate differences in hepatocellular carcinoma prevention between two drugs. Systematic searches were conducted using PubMed, Embase, and Web of Science to identify original meta-analyses. Finally, twelve studies were included for quantitative analyses. We found that TDF treatment was associated with a significantly lower risk of HCC than ETV (hazard ratio, 0.80; 95% CI 0.75-0.86, p < 0.05). The lower risk of HCC in patients given TDF compared with ETV persisted in subgroup analyses performed with propensity score-matched cohorts, cirrhosis cohorts, nucleos(t)ide naïve cohorts and Asian cohorts. In the cohorts of non-Asia and patients without cirrhosis, there was no difference exhibited between these two drugs. Subsequent analyses showed TDF treatment was also associated with a lower incidence of death or transplantation than patients receiving ETV. Overall, the preventive effect of these two drugs on HCC has been studied in several published meta-analyses, but few were graded as high-quality evidence, meanwhile, most of which had high overlap. Thus, future researchers should include updated cohorts or conduct prospective RCTs to further explore this issue.

Talimtzi P, Ntolkeras A, Kostopoulos G, Bougioukas KI, Pagkalidou E, Ouranidis A, Pataka A, Haidich AB. The reporting completeness and transparency of systematic reviews of prognostic prediction models for COVID-19 was poor: a methodological overview of systematic reviews. J Clin Epidemiol 2024; 167:111264. [PMID: 38266742 DOI: 10.1016/j.jclinepi.2024.111264] [Citation(s) in RCA: 1]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/26/2023] [Revised: 01/08/2024] [Accepted: 01/13/2024] [Indexed: 01/26/2024]
Abstract
OBJECTIVES To conduct a methodological overview of reviews to evaluate the reporting completeness and transparency of systematic reviews (SRs) of prognostic prediction models (PPMs) for COVID-19. STUDY DESIGN AND SETTING MEDLINE, Scopus, Cochrane Database of Systematic Reviews, and Epistemonikos (epistemonikos.org) were searched for SRs of PPMs for COVID-19 until December 31, 2022. The risk of bias in systematic reviews tool was used to assess the risk of bias. The protocol for this overview was uploaded in the Open Science Framework (https://osf.io/7y94c). RESULTS Ten SRs were retrieved; none of them synthesized the results in a meta-analysis. For most of the studies, there was absence of a predefined protocol and missing information on study selection, data collection process, and reporting of primary studies and models included, while only one SR had its data publicly available. In addition, for the majority of the SRs, the overall risk of bias was judged as being high. The overall corrected covered area was 6.3% showing a small amount of overlapping among the SRs. CONCLUSION The reporting completeness and transparency of SRs of PPMs for COVID-19 was poor. Guidance is urgently required, with increased awareness and education of minimum reporting standards and quality criteria. Specific focus is needed in predefined protocol, information on study selection and data collection process, and in the reporting of findings to improve the quality of SRs of PPMs for COVID-19.

Nemzoff C, Shah HA, Heupink LF, Regan L, Ghosh S, Pincombe M, Guzman J, Sweeney S, Ruiz F, Vassall A. Adaptive Health Technology Assessment: A Scoping Review of Methods. VALUE IN HEALTH : THE JOURNAL OF THE INTERNATIONAL SOCIETY FOR PHARMACOECONOMICS AND OUTCOMES RESEARCH 2023; 26:1549-1557. [PMID: 37285917 DOI: 10.1016/j.jval.2023.05.017]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 11/13/2022] [Revised: 04/13/2023] [Accepted: 05/28/2023] [Indexed: 06/09/2023]
Abstract
OBJECTIVES Health technology assessment (HTA) is an established mechanism for explicit priority setting to support universal health coverage. However, full HTA requires significant time, data, and capacity for each intervention, which limits the number of decisions it can inform. Another approach systematically adapts full HTA methods by leveraging HTA evidence from other settings. We call this "adaptive" HTA (aHTA), although in settings where time is the main constraint, it is also called "rapid HTA." METHODS The objectives of this scoping review were to identify and map existing aHTA methods, and to assess their triggers, strengths, and weaknesses. This was done by searching HTA agencies' and networks' websites, and the published literature. Findings have been narratively synthesized. RESULTS This review identified 20 countries and 1 HTA network with aHTA methods in the Americas, Europe, Africa, and South-East Asia. These methods have been characterized into 5 types: rapid reviews, rapid cost-effectiveness analyses, rapid manufacturer submissions, transfers, and de facto HTA. Three characteristics "trigger" the use of aHTA instead of full HTA: urgency, certainty, and low budget impact. Sometimes, an iterative approach to selecting methods guides whether to do aHTA or full HTA. aHTA was found to be faster and more efficient, useful for decision makers, and to reduce duplication. Nevertheless, there is limited standardization, transparency, and measurement of uncertainty. CONCLUSIONS aHTA is used in many settings. It has potential to improve the efficiency of any priority-setting system, but needs to be better formalized to improve uptake, particularly for nascent HTA systems.

Bracchiglione J, Meza N, Pérez-Carrasco I, Vergara-Merino L, Madrid E, Urrútia G, Bonfill Cosp X. A methodological review finds mismatch between overall and pairwise overlap analysis in a sample of overviews. J Clin Epidemiol 2023; 159:31-39. [PMID: 37164290 DOI: 10.1016/j.jclinepi.2023.05.006] [Citation(s) in RCA: 6]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/18/2023] [Revised: 04/30/2023] [Accepted: 05/01/2023] [Indexed: 05/12/2023]
Abstract
OBJECTIVES Overlap of primary studies is a key methodological challenge for overviews. There are limited reports of methods used to address overlap, and there is no detailed assessment of the corrected covered area (CCA) of a representative sample of overviews. To describe the approaches used to address overlap, and to estimate the overall and pairwise CCA. METHODS We searched PubMed for overviews published in 2018. Two authors conducted the screening process. We described the strategy used for assessing overlap, and calculated overall and pairwise CCA for each overview. RESULTS We analyzed a random sample of 30 out of 89 eligible articles. Eleven did not address the overlap. Of the remainder, most frequent strategies were visual assessment and discussion of overlap as a limitation. Median overall CCA among the included overviews was 6.7%. The pairwise analysis showed that 52.8% of SR pairs had slight overlap, while 28.3% had very high overlap. CONCLUSION Reported strategies for addressing overlap vary considerably among overview authors. The pairwise approach for assessing the CCA revealed highly overlapped pairs of SRs in overviews with overall slight overlap and vice versa. We encourage authors to complement the overall CCA assessment with a pairwise approach.

Türk S, Korfmacher AK, Gerger H, van der Oord S, Christiansen H. Interventions for ADHD in childhood and adolescence: A systematic umbrella review and meta-meta-analysis. Clin Psychol Rev 2023; 102:102271. [PMID: 37030086 DOI: 10.1016/j.cpr.2023.102271]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/08/2022] [Revised: 03/03/2023] [Accepted: 03/24/2023] [Indexed: 03/28/2023]
Abstract
There are several meta-analyses of treatment effects for children and adolescents with attention deficit hyperactivity disorder (ADHD). The conclusions of these meta-analyses vary considerably. Our aim was to synthesize the latest evidence of the effectiveness of psychological, pharmacological treatment options and their combination in a systematic overview and meta-meta-analyses. A systematic literature search until July 2022 to identify meta-analyses investigating effects of treatments for children and adolescents with ADHD and ADHD symptom severity as primary outcome (parent and teacher rated) yielded 16 meta-analyses for quantitative analyses. Meta-meta-analyses of pre-post data showed significant effects for pharmacological treatment options for parent (SMD = 0.67, 95% CI 0.60 to 0.74) and teacher ADHD symptom ratings (SMD = 0.68, 95% CI 0.54 to 0.82) as well as for psychological interventions for parent (SMD = 0.42, 95% CI 0.33 to 0.51) and teacher rated symptoms (SMD = 0.25, 95% CI 0.12 to 0.38). We were unable to calculate effect sizes for combined treatments due to the lack of meta-analyses. Our analyses revealed that there is a lack of research on combined treatments and for therapy options for adolescents. Finally, future research efforts should adhere to scientific standards as this allows comparison of effects across meta-analyses.

Kim JSM, Pollock M, Kaunelis D, Weeks L. Guidance on review type selection for health technology assessments: key factors and considerations for deciding when to conduct a de novo systematic review, an update of a systematic review, or an overview of systematic reviews. Syst Rev 2022; 11:206. [PMID: 36167611 PMCID: PMC9513959 DOI: 10.1186/s13643-022-02071-7]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 07/06/2021] [Accepted: 09/11/2022] [Indexed: 11/18/2022] Open
Abstract
BACKGROUND A systematic review (SR) helps us make sense of a body of research while minimizing bias and is routinely conducted to evaluate intervention effects in a health technology assessment (HTA). In addition to the traditional de novo SR, which combines the results of multiple primary studies, there are alternative review types that use systematic methods and leverage existing SRs, namely updates of SRs and overviews of SRs. This paper shares guidance that can be used to select the most appropriate review type to conduct when evaluating intervention effects in an HTA, with a goal to leverage existing SRs and reduce research waste where possible. PROCESS We identified key factors and considerations that can inform the process of deciding to conduct one review type over the others to answer a research question and organized them into guidance comprising a summary and a corresponding flowchart. This work consisted of three steps. First, a guidance document was drafted by methodologists from two Canadian HTA agencies based on their experience. Next, the draft guidance was supplemented with a literature review. Lastly, broader feedback from HTA researchers across Canada was sought and incorporated into the final guidance. INSIGHTS Nine key factors and six considerations were identified to help reviewers select the most appropriate review type to conduct. These fell into one of two categories: the evidentiary needs of the planned review (i.e., to understand the scope, objective, and analytic approach required for the review) and the state of the existing literature (i.e., to know the available literature in terms of its relevance, quality, comprehensiveness, currency, and findings). The accompanying flowchart, which can be used as a decision tool, demonstrates the interdependency between many of the key factors and considerations and aims to balance the potential benefits and challenges of leveraging existing SRs instead of primary study reports. CONCLUSIONS Selecting the most appropriate review type to conduct when evaluating intervention effects in an HTA requires a myriad of factors to be considered. We hope this guidance adds clarity to the many competing considerations when deciding which review type to conduct and facilitates that decision-making process.

Raine G, Khouja C, Scott R, Wright K, Sowden AJ. Pornography use and sexting amongst children and young people: a systematic overview of reviews. Syst Rev 2020; 9:283. [PMID: 33280603 PMCID: PMC7720575 DOI: 10.1186/s13643-020-01541-0] [Citation(s) in RCA: 9]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 01/31/2020] [Accepted: 11/23/2020] [Indexed: 12/30/2022] Open
Abstract
BACKGROUND Young people's use of pornography and participation in sexting are commonly viewed as harmful behaviours. This paper reports findings from a 'review of reviews', which aimed to systematically identify and synthesise the evidence on pornography and sexting amongst young people. Here, we focus specifically on the evidence relating to young people's use of pornography; involvement in sexting; and their beliefs, attitudes, behaviours and wellbeing to better understand potential harms and benefits, and identify where future research is required. METHODS We searched five health and social science databases; searches for grey literature were also performed. Review quality was assessed and findings synthesised narratively. RESULTS Eleven reviews of quantitative and/or qualitative studies were included. A relationship was identified between pornography use and more permissive sexual attitudes. An association between pornography use and stronger gender-stereotypical sexual beliefs was also reported, but not consistently. Similarly, inconsistent evidence of an association between pornography use and sexting and sexual behaviour was identified. Pornography use has been associated with various forms of sexual violence, aggression and harassment, but the relationship appears complex. Girls, in particular, may experience coercion and pressure to engage in sexting and suffer more negative consequences than boys if sexts become public. Positive aspects to sexting were reported, particularly in relation to young people's personal relationships. CONCLUSIONS We identified evidence from reviews of varying quality that linked pornography use and sexting amongst young people to specific beliefs, attitudes and behaviours. However, evidence was often inconsistent and mostly derived from observational studies using a cross-sectional design, which precludes establishing any causal relationship. Other methodological limitations and evidence gaps were identified. More rigorous quantitative studies and greater use of qualitative methods are required.

Seifo N, Cassie H, Radford JR, Innes NPT. Silver diamine fluoride for managing carious lesions: an umbrella review. BMC Oral Health 2019; 19:145. [PMID: 31299955 PMCID: PMC6626340 DOI: 10.1186/s12903-019-0830-5] [Citation(s) in RCA: 96] [Impact Index Per Article: 16.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/16/2019] [Accepted: 06/23/2019] [Indexed: 12/26/2022] Open
Abstract
BACKGROUND This umbrella review comprehensively appraised evidence for silver diamine fluoride (SDF) to arrest and prevent root and coronal caries by summarizing systematic reviews. Adverse events were explored. METHODS Following Preferred Reporting Items for Systematic Reviews and Meta-analysis (PRISMA) guidelines, PubMed, Embase, Cochrane Library, PROSPERO register and Joanna Briggs Institute Database of Systematic Reviews were searched for systematic reviews investigating SDF for caries prevention or arrest (1970-2018) without language restrictions. Systematic reviews were selected, data extracted, and risk of bias assessed using ROBIS by two independent reviewers, in duplicate. Corrected covered area was calculated to quantify studies' overlap across reviews. RESULTS Eleven systematic reviews were included; four focussing on SDF for root caries in adults and seven on coronal caries in children. These cited 30 studies (4 root caries; 26 coronal caries) appearing 63 times. Five systematic reviews were of "low", one "unclear" and five "high" risk of bias. Overlap of studies was very high (50% root caries; 17% coronal caries). High overlap and heterogeneity, mainly comparators and outcome measures, precluded meta-analysis. Results were grouped by aim and outcomes to present an overview of direction and magnitude of effect. SDF had a positive effect on prevention and arrest of coronal and root caries, consistently outperforming comparators (fluoride varnish, Atraumatic Restorative Treatment, placebo). For root caries prevention, the prevented fraction (PF) was 25-71% higher for SDF compared to placebo (two systematic reviews with three studies) and PF = 100-725% for root caries arrest (one systematic review with two studies). For coronal caries prevention, PF = 70-78% (two systematic reviews with two studies) and PF = 55-96% for coronal caries arrest (one systematic review with two studies) with arrest rates of 65-91% (four systematic reviews with six studies). Eight systematic reviews reported adverse events, seven of which reported arrested lesions black staining. CONCLUSION Systematic reviews consistently supported SDF's effectiveness for arresting coronal caries in the primary dentition and arresting and preventing root caries in older adults for all comparators. There is insufficient evidence to draw conclusions on SDF for prevention in primary teeth and prevention and arrest in permanent teeth in children. No serious adverse events were reported.

Unkel S, Amiri M, Benda N, Beyersmann J, Knoerzer D, Kupas K, Langer F, Leverkus F, Loos A, Ose C, Proctor T, Schmoor C, Schwenke C, Skipka G, Unnebrink K, Voss F, Friede T. On estimands and the analysis of adverse events in the presence of varying follow-up times within the benefit assessment of therapies. Pharm Stat 2019; 18:166-183. [PMID: 30458579 PMCID: PMC6587465 DOI: 10.1002/pst.1915] [Citation(s) in RCA: 44] [Impact Index Per Article: 7.3]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/03/2018] [Revised: 09/19/2018] [Accepted: 10/23/2018] [Indexed: 12/21/2022]
Abstract
The analysis of adverse events (AEs) is a key component in the assessment of a drug's safety profile. Inappropriate analysis methods may result in misleading conclusions about a therapy's safety and consequently its benefit-risk ratio. The statistical analysis of AEs is complicated by the fact that the follow-up times can vary between the patients included in a clinical trial. This paper takes as its focus the analysis of AE data in the presence of varying follow-up times within the benefit assessment of therapeutic interventions. Instead of approaching this issue directly and solely from an analysis point of view, we first discuss what should be estimated in the context of safety data, leading to the concept of estimands. Although the current discussion on estimands is mainly related to efficacy evaluation, the concept is applicable to safety endpoints as well. Within the framework of estimands, we present statistical methods for analysing AEs with the focus being on the time to the occurrence of the first AE of a specific type. We give recommendations which estimators should be used for the estimands described. Furthermore, we state practical implications of the analysis of AEs in clinical trials and give an overview of examples across different indications. We also provide a review of current practices of health technology assessment (HTA) agencies with respect to the evaluation of safety data. Finally, we describe problems with meta-analyses of AE data and sketch possible solutions.

Ballard M, Montgomery P. Risk of bias in overviews of reviews: a scoping review of methodological guidance and four-item checklist. Res Synth Methods 2017; 8:92-108. [PMID: 28074553 DOI: 10.1002/jrsm.1229] [Citation(s) in RCA: 77] [Impact Index Per Article: 9.6]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/10/2016] [Revised: 08/16/2016] [Accepted: 09/27/2016] [Indexed: 01/09/2023]
Abstract
OBJECTIVE To assess the conditions under which employing an overview of systematic reviews is likely to lead to a high risk of bias. STUDY DESIGN To synthesise existing guidance concerning overview practice, a scoping review was conducted. Four electronic databases were searched with a pre-specified strategy (PROSPERO 2015:CRD42015027592) ending October 2015. Included studies needed to describe or develop overview methodology. Data were narratively synthesised to delineate areas highlighted as outstanding challenges or where methodological recommendations conflict. RESULTS Twenty-four papers met the inclusion criteria. There is emerging debate regarding overlapping systematic reviews; systematic review scope; quality of included research; updating; and synthesizing and reporting results. While three functions for overviews have been proposed-identify gaps, explore heterogeneity, summarize evidence-overviews cannot perform the first; are unlikely to achieve the second and third simultaneously; and can only perform the third under specific circumstances. Namely, when identified systematic reviews meet the following four conditions: (1) include primary trials that do not substantially overlap, (2) match overview scope, (3) are of high methodological quality, and (4) are up-to-date. CONCLUSION Considering the intended function of proposed overviews with the corresponding methodological conditions may improve the quality of this burgeoning publication type.
